示例#1
0
文件: WUI.cs 项目: ech0array/chunx
    internal bool UnstackCurrent()
    {
        WUIMenu wUIMenu = baseComponents.wUIMenuStack.Peek();

        if (wUIMenu == null)
        {
            return(true);
        }
        wUIMenu.Unstack();
        return(baseComponents.wUIMenuStack.Count == 0);
    }
示例#2
0
    private void PerformAction()
    {
        if (_closeParentMenu)
        {
            // Close parent menu
            WUIMenu wUIMenu = base.gameObject.GetComponentInParent <WUIMenu>();
            if (wUIMenu != null)
            {
                wUIMenu.Unstack();
            }
        }

        onClick.Invoke();
    }